tspauldi808 says: You'll need: Good hiking Shoes Comfy clothes Camera Water Energy snack sunscreen (optional) Be in good hiking health Trail is well kept but steep in some areas. Trail is dirt, so beware on rainy days. Permits MUST be obtained before hiking down to Kalaupapa. The official tour is highly r...

daaaaave says: If you are heading to Diamond Head, make sure you take the bus. You can hop on at any bus stop (there are a bunch in Waikiki). Number 22, 23 will take you there. The park closes at 600pm (which is just before sunset, unfortunately). The guide says it takes 45 min. to climb, but you can easily ...
